液氯罐区封闭化设计实例

An Example for Closed Design of Liquid Chlorine Tank Area

摘要 以某精细化工企业建设项目为例,通过对工艺条件进行整理与分析,选择了位差抽卸的卸车工艺,根据使用需求和经济原则确定了液氯罐区封闭厂房布置方案。按照确定的厂房布置方案,从自动化、电信、消防、电气、土建等专业对厂房进行了设计。液氯罐区的密闭化设计,能够从源头上预防和减少因液氯泄漏导致的安全事故,提升了液氯储运过程的本质安全水平。 Taking a construction project of a fine chemical enterprise as an example,the process of differential pumping was selected by sorting and analyzing the process conditions.The layout scheme for closed workshop of liquid chlorine tank area was determined according to the demand of utilizations and economy principle.The plant has been designed from several professional of automation,telecommunication,fire protection,electrical,civil engineering and so on according to the determined plant layout scheme.The safety accidents caused by liquid chlorine leakage from the source can be prevented and reduced through the closed design of liquid chlorine tank area,and it improves the essential safety level of liquid chlorine storage and transportation.
